Output 3c72e9dec36ad8728ed4afc6816f94a95ef5c0a096927f7b16ef843bae63700c:6

value
58875478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b046a56d85ac8e7835d68b8d4c5a1780a8610b OP_EQUAL
address
MRZHpKdTcTHaEDeKag8XuTtHVuKVaFf71G
transaction
3c72e9dec36ad8728ed4afc6816f94a95ef5c0a096927f7b16ef843bae63700c
spent
true